California's New Minimum Wage: Low-Wage Workers by Region [EconTax Blog]

Dec 6, 2016 - Data Source: 2015 American Community Survey (ACS). The ACS is an annual household survey conducted by the Census Bureau that covers basic economic and demographic information. The ACS ’s large sample sizes and level of geographic detail make it useful for regional analyses.

[PDF] Department of Real Estate: Opportunities to Improve Consumer Protection

Figure 8 summarizes DRE disciplinary ac- tions by type of violation for a recent one-year period—from March 2007 to February 2008. As the figure shows, of all the disciplinary ac- tions brought by DRE during that period, 379, or 59 percent, involved a licensee who was arrested and convicted (mostly by local authorities) of one or more crimes.

An issue has arisen regarding the transition costs in 2010-11 of switching to a new fiscal intermediary (FI) for Medi-Cal. The Department of Health Care Services (DHCS) estimates the new contract will

Apr 23, 2010 - In early 2010, DHCS selected Xerox/ACS as the new FI. The DHCS obtained federal approval for the new FI and signed a contract with Xerox/ACS on March 31, 2010, with an effective contract start date of May 1, 2010.
